Each player gets 3 cards. Aces count as 1, picture cards count as 10, all other cards have their face value. If you have any repeated values, you swap cards until you have 3 different values. Whoever can make the most different numbers by adding and subtracting the values of their cards wins, and gets to go on the special mission!

In Phase 10, players count points by adding up the total value of the cards in their hand that are not part of a completed phase. Points are scored based on the number on each card, with special cards like Skip cards and Wild cards having their own point values. The player with the lowest total points at the end of each round is the winner.
A standard deck of cards contains 52 cards, divided into four suits: hearts, diamonds, clubs, and spades. Each suit has 13 cards, including numbered cards from 2 to 10, and face cards: Jack (J), Queen (Q), and King (K), along with an Ace (A). The total of 52 cards does not include the Jokers, which are often found in some decks but are not part of the standard count.

To count cribbage hands effectively, assign point values to each card and combination of cards, then add up the points in your hand. Keep track of different combinations that can earn points, such as pairs, runs, and fifteens. Practice and familiarity with the point values will help you count cribbage hands quickly and accurately.
In Uno, players count points by adding up the values of the cards they have left in their hand at the end of each round. Number cards are worth their face value, while special cards like Skip, Reverse, and Draw Two are worth 20 points, and Wild and Wild Draw Four cards are worth 50 points. The first player to reach 500 points wins the game.
